We had a 1990 F150 with the V8 gas engine that was a really good truck. When it got wrecked late in 2002 it had well over 300,000 miles showing. I had the transmission rebuilt several years before that and had the intake gasket replaced but other that that all other repairs were routine stuff like a new exhaust system, etc. Every fw years there seems to be a new "leader" in the industry, but from what I saw in the year range your talking about you can't beat a Ford.
